Why Rose Glow Barberry Shrubs?
Fast-growing and adaptable to tough conditions, the Rose Glow Barberry Shrub delights with unbelievable color. Simply pick a spot where it can show off its natural arching branches and bright hues!
The show starts with rose and burgundy growth in spring. Rose marbling on new spring leaves gives the Barberry its name, with color that transitions to a stunning shade of burgundy as it matures.
Tiny yellow spring blooms take over, followed by black-purple berries that turn red in winter. And it thrives almost anywhere, from the cold northern winters to the heat of the southeast and the arid west.

1. Planting: Dig a hole large enough to accommodate your Rose Glow's rootball, backfill the soil and water to settle the roots.
Generally, the Rose Glow prefers well-drained soil and full to partial sun (4 to 6 hours of sunlight).
2. Watering: Let your soil dry to the touch down to about 2 inches in between waterings. Once your soil is dry, give your Rose Glow a deep watering at the base.
3. Fertilizing: Fertilize your Rose Glow at the beginning of every spring with a well-balanced fertilizer blend, and follow label instructions.
